Banjo Strain — Savory Sedation

If you’re just not a dessert lover, you might find all the super sweet strains available today not to your liking. That’s where Banjo comes in, a savory cannabis strain that still has hints of juicy tangerines to keep everything balanced. Each puff of this hybrid will put you in the right mood for serious relaxation that leaves you melting into the couch.

Banjo Strain Information

This weed strain is known for creating calming and relaxing effects, but many people find that they don’t drift off to sleep after enjoying it. That makes it a good fit for edible recipes designed to combat stress or pain that you’d like to use during the day. Keep in mind that any THC drug test you take after using this strain will come up positive, thanks to the THC content that can run as high as 28%.

The History of Banjo Strain

Breeders crossed the Tangelo strain with Boost to create this unique strain. It’s not commonly seen as a strain used for CBD products because of its high THC content.
